Full Stack Developer -python

Simreka , Bangalore · simreka.com · Full-time employment · Programming

Job description

CTC : Up to 30% Hike on current

What you'll work on:

You will be responsible for the development of server-side logic, ensuring high performance and responsiveness to requests from the front end. You will also be responsible for integrating the front-end elements built by your co-workers into the application; therefore, a basic understanding of front-end technologies is necessary as well. Ultimately, through your contribution to the renewable energy revolution, you will be doing your bit to mitigate the effects of climate change, make manufacturing sustainable, help R&D teams to perform virtual experiments, and discover new materials and manufacturing processes.


  1. 3+ years experience in building web applications with Python
  2. Knowledge of PHP is an advantage
  3. Experience in building an end-to-end Web Applications
  4. Working knowledge in HTML, JavaScript, AJAX.
  5. Knowledge of data transmission methodologies and protocols (eg. XML / JSON) and web services like REST
  6. Strong knowledge of Data structures and algorithms
  7. Knowledge of Cloud platforms like AWS, Azure, GCP
  8. Worked on RDBS and NoSQL database
  9. Familiarity with the JavaScript framework including NodeJS, Angular, React, and Amber
  10. Familiarity with MongoDB, MySQL, Docker, and GIT would be a value-add
  11. Must be comfortable in writing REST calls
  12. Positive attitude and excellent communication skills
  13. Creative approach to problem-solving, be adaptable, proactive, and willing to take ownership.


  1. Write effective, scalable code.
  2. Develop back-end components to improve responsiveness and overall performance.
  3. Improve functionality of existing systems.
  4. Build reusable code and libraries for future use.
  5. Maintain codebase and implement any necessary additions or enhancements
  6. Building simple, efficient, and reusable applications.
  7. Identify and communicate back-end best practices.
  8. Participate in the project life-cycle to develop applications using agile methodologies.
  9. Analyze and improve the performance, scalability, stability, and security of the product.
  10. Strong understanding of Web Services, Caching, Scalability, REST/SOAP Principles
  11. Collaborate with data scientists, software engineers, and architects on product development.

What You Get at Simreka:

  1. Working on Bleeding edge technology
  2. Working in a fast-growing enterprise software product company.
  3. Competitive salary
  4. Technical coaching to ensure continuous professional growth
  5. Career coaching by our expert and senior mentors
  6. Awards, incentives & recognition for your hard work

Apply for this position

Login with Google or GitHub to see instructions on how to apply. Your identity will not be revealed to the employer.

It is NOT OK for recruiters, HR consultants, and other intermediaries to contact this employer